The Ved Prachar Mandal, Punjab, organised an Inter-School Vedic Speech Competition at then school. The programme began with the lighting of lamp by Principal Kamalveer Kaur, Rajiv Kheda, retired General Manager, Punjab National Bank, Sanjeev Gupta, and others. Twenty-five schools participated in the competition, and students spoke on various topics related to Vedic culture and current issues. Awards were given to the winners, and the programme concluded with a vote of thanks by Dr Vandana Shahi. The first prize was bagged by Hrishti, Bharatiya Vidya Mandir, Kichlu Nagar. The second prize was bagged by Ek Roop Kaur, DAV Public School, BRS Nagar, and Palak Sharma, DAV Public School, Pakhowal Road. The third prize was jointly won by Advika Kaul, BCM Arya Model Senior Secondary School, Shastri Nagar, and Ansh Sharma, Bharatiya Vidya Mandir Senior Secondary School, Sector 39. Appreciation awards were given to Ek Noor Kaur, Guru Nanak International Public School, Model Town, and Namanpal Singh, Guru Nanak International Public School, BRS Nagar.
